Sleep Training by Visible-Sport-1673 in NewDads

[–]ThatOtterGuy2 0 points1 point  (0 children)

There's a sleep reflex in newborns around that age where they wake up after an approximate 30 minute sleep cycle. If you can be nearby, there is a soothing technique involving gently rocking them in the bassinet/crib, pacifier in, for 5-10 minutes. This was incredibly helpful for us, we didn't feel like we had to start the whole cycle since she remained in the bassinet.

Need advice going back to work with newborn by Dapper_University168 in NewDads

[–]ThatOtterGuy2 1 point2 points  (0 children)

Do you guys have a bassinet? When she does the afternoon feeding starting around the 12-2pm range (when us 9-5ers go for that second cup of coffee) can she sleep while baby sleeps?

I don’t think you’re being unreasonable, it’s just a tough balancing act. You are headed back to work, your wife is going through some incredible biological changes, and she is the one providing food for your child every ~3 hours. I commit to getting up once each night guaranteed, and if extra help is needed then such is life. We are about a week out from introducing bottles and I will likely be taking the one night feed. That being said… the wife is still getting up to pump during that bottle feed. If she doesn’t (per our LC, do your own research) we run the risk of her supply diminishing. So she’s getting up every 3-5 hours at night regardless.
